Employee Type: Regular The senior geologist will be responsible for organizing and interpreting geologic data as needed to develop stratified gridded and block geologic models and reports. This position will plan, organize and oversee drilling programs to support marketing initiatives and mining operations as needed. The senior geologist will also prepare Mineral Resource and Mineral Reserve Disclosures for various regulatory organizations.

Job Description:

Essential Duties:

  • Interpret drill hole geophysical logs, lithological logs and assays to determine the thickness, depth and/or volume of various geologic units
  • Organize and QA/QC large quantities of geologic data to prepare input files for geologic computer models
  • Construct and validate geologic computer models using Vulcan, Origin or similar software
  • Plan, organize and conduct drilling programs to support marketing activities and mining operations as needed, including:
    • Determining the number, type and location of drill holes and core holes needed to meet an objective
    • Planning and estimating cost
    • Preparing requests for proposal for various drilling program contractors, evaluating contractor bids, making selection recommendations, and preparing contractor contracts
  • Leading the drilling program, including:
    • Supervising drilling crews and geophysical logging crews
    • Preparing drill hole cuttings and core lithological descriptions
    • Packaging and arranging core sample shipments to the laboratory for analysis
  • Preparing maps, cross-sections, resource and reserve estimates and text for various technical reports and mine permit applications

Other duties:

  • Presenting geologic information to company management and outside parties
  • Investigating geologic problems and requests for information as needed
